Web presidential signing statements are official pronouncements issued by the president of the united states at or near the time a bill is signed into law. Web a “signing statement” is a written comment issued by a president at the time of signing legislation. Signing statement, written comment issued by the executive of a government when signing a bill into law. Web signing statement a written declaration that a president may make when signing a bill into law. Web the statement may address how the executive branch intends to interpret or enforce provisions of the new law. For example, a signing statement might declare that the president believes a part of the law is unconstitutional.
